The Schindelhauer Emilia is a fully equipped all-round e-bike. Thanks to the MAHLE X20 motor with 55 Nm of torque, the bike offers superb riding dynamics, and the carbon belt requires no grease or oil. This means no grease stains on your trousers. The highlight: the battery is concealed within the down tube, giving the bike a clean, elegant look.
Comfortable, functional and characterised by a minimalist design. Another highlight is the frame-mounted front luggage rack with a clever tension strap system. Even larger loads can be transported safely without affecting handling. The LightSKIN Ultra-Mini-Light U2E, the world’s smallest StVZO-compliant front bike light, integrated into the aluminium mudguard, ensures optimum visibility at night.
The 250-watt motor discreetly integrated in the rear hub and the 250Wh battery placed in the down tube offer lasting riding pleasure thanks to reliable components from Mahle. Control and individual riding profiles are easily accessible with just one press of a button on the frame or via app.
Emilia's urge to move can be optimally transferred to the road using the sequential gearbox from Pinion with either 6 or 9 gears. Developed by former Porsche engineers, even precise gear changes are possible, whether stationary or while riding.
Thanks to the adapted Schindelhauer frame geometry with longer head tube and shorter stem, Emilia has a comfortable seating position. Cobblestone streets and rough park paths become your new favorite shortcut thanks to the large-volume tires. With the Gates Carbon Drive toothed belt, three to four times higher mileage is possible compared to a chain - with the same efficiency, but less maintenance and noise. Oiling and greasing are a thing of the past, as are dirty trouser legs.
| Frame | Aluminum (AL6061-T6), Aero-Shape tube set, triple-butted, forged bottom bracket shell, forged dropout with sliding dropout system and Schindelhauer – Belt Port, integrated motor connector, integrated seat clamp, smoothed welds, internal cable routing |
| Fork | Hydroforming aluminum fork (tapered), internal cable routing, disc brake post mount, 15 mm thru-axle |
| Headset | Acros - ICR 1.5'' |
| Motor | Mahle X20 – Hub Drive, 250 W power, 55 Nm, 12 mm ThroughAxle, assistance up to 25 km/h |
| Battery | Mahle X20 – Intube battery with approx. 250 Wh energy content |
| Onboard computer | Mahle X20 - Head Unit in top tube, with Bluetooth and ANT+ |
| Drive | Gates Carbon Drive CDX, front 39T, rear 34T/28T, toothed belt 118T/115T |
| Gearing | Pinion – Gearbox unit, C-Line 6-/ 9-speed (XR) |
| Bottom bracket | Pinion |
| Crankset | Pinion |
| Pedals | VP – Plastic with GripTape, industrial bearing |
| Stem | Satori – Stealth, aluminum |
| Handlebars | Schindelhauer - CITY, aluminum |
| Saddle | Selle Royal - Essenza moderate |
| Seatpost | Schindelhauer |
| Grips | Schindelhauer |
| Wheels | Schindelhauer – StraightPull front hub disc, Mahle - X20 Hub Motor StraightPull, Kinlin - TL23R, Sapim – Race spokes, laced 3-cross and 2-cross |
| Brakes | Shimano – MT200 disc brake (hydraulic) 160 mm |
| Tires | Continental Contact Urban 50-584, with reflective stripe |
| Weight | 17.6 kg (6-speed)/17.9 kg (9-speed) |
| Max. total weight | 130 kg (bicycle + rider + luggage) |
| Mudguards | Curana – Apollo (aluminum profile mudguards) |
| Luggage rack | Schindelhauer – Aluminum, frame-mounted, with VarioStrap system |
| Lighting | LightSKIN Ultra-Mini-Light U2E front and ILU jr. rear |
| Other features | Kickstand mounting possible, bottle or lock holder mounting and frame lock possible |
